How they compare
Latvia currently reports 81,616 1000 USD against 81,432 1000 USD in Dominican Republic, a difference of 184 1000 USD.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 33 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Dominican Republic ahead.
Dominican Republic ranks 74th and Latvia ranks 73rd of 236 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Dominican Republic averaged higher in 1 and Latvia in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Dominican Republic | Latvia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 11,502 1000 USD | 3,004 1000 USD | 8,498 1000 USD | Dominican Republic |
| 2000s | 16,712 1000 USD | 41,026 1000 USD | 24,314 1000 USD | Latvia |
| 2010s | 33,496 1000 USD | 69,789 1000 USD | 36,293 1000 USD | Latvia |
| 2020s | 59,476 1000 USD | 112,796 1000 USD | 53,320 1000 USD | Latvia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products. More detailed information on wood products, including definitions, can be found at: https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en
